A JEW LIVING IN OCEAN COUNTY
Last week a long-time friend of mine from North Jersey, who now lives in Manchester, took me on a tour of the Kosher markets and stores in the Lakewood/Toms River Area. Oh my goodness!!! Along Route 70 there is a plethora of places to purchase kosher and holiday items. I was like a baby in a candy store. I have traveled into Lakewood to shop but going down Route 9 takes forever and these stores can be found right off the GSP (Exit 89A). Our first stop was Bingo Wholesale, a huge store with everything you can think of. The produce looked very fresh and the store was bright and clean. I was able to stock up with some delicious pareve cakes for our onegs at the JCC. We stopped at some other places and finally ended our tour at the Trader Joe's which carries many kosher items (check their web site for list of kosher items).
Besides the shopping opportunities, it was a wonderful feeling to be surrounded by so many Jewish people.
It's kinda like the feeling I had in Israel. In fact, I made a new friend with a Orthodox mom and her two little ones who we kept on meeting on our tour.

TD AFFINITY PROGRAM
|
Easy money!
Do you have an account with TD Bank?
You can contribute to the JCC without it costing you a cent. TD Bank will pay us on the number of accounts in our TD Affinity Club. There is no minimum number of members. We automatically receive $10 for every checking account and .01% of the balance on Savings Accounts. In addition we receive $50 for any new accounts. This is strictly confidential and the JCC does not know the amount in any of the accounts.
